Few Sydney swimming spots can rival the charm of Andrew Boy Charlton Pool. Standing tall over Woolloomooloo Bay, with the Royal Botanic Garden on one side and sweeping views across the harbour on the other, this gem has been a favourite of locals and visitors for generations. In 2021, it was announced that the long-vacant space on Oxford Street, formerly home to the West Olympia Theatre and later the Grand Pacific Blue Room, would be transformed into Australia’s first 25hours Hotel. True to its cinematic history, it will be named 25 Hours Olympia, an ode to the former theatre.
